Taylor Swift's song "All Of The Girls You Loved Before" delves into the intricate nuances of love, heartbreak, and the journey towards self-discovery. Through poignant lyrics and emotive melodies, Swift offers listeners a glimpse into her reflections on past relationships and the profound experiences that culminated in finding genuine love.

The song unfolds as a narrative of intimate moments, capturing the essence of late nights filled with emotional turmoil and the relentless pursuit of authentic connection. Swift eloquently portrays the paradoxical feeling of loneliness despite being in the company of another, evoking a sense of longing and yearning for a deeper emotional bond.

Central to the song's thematic core is the chorus, where Swift expresses profound gratitude towards her partner's past relationships. She acknowledges that each previous love affair ultimately paved the way for their union, underscoring the significance of the journey that led them to each other. Despite the pain and heartache embedded in their pasts, Swift finds solace in the realization that every twist and turn served a purpose in shaping their present.

The verses unravel layers of vulnerability, insecurity, and the complexities of navigating through the trials of love. Swift candidly reflects on the facade of artificial affection, juxtaposed with moments of raw emotion and tears shed in solitude over past heartbreaks. These introspective musings shed light on the transformative nature of romantic encounters and their profound impact on personal growth.

In the bridge of the song, Swift delves into the formative influence of upbringing and past experiences on one's approach to love and relationships. She acknowledges the invaluable lessons gleaned from teenage infatuation and the enduring imprint of maternal guidance on her partner's character. Through this introspective lens, Swift articulates a desire to cultivate a love that transcends the scars of past wounds.

As the song crescendos towards its final chorus, Swift delivers a resounding affirmation of her love and appreciation for her partner. She emphasizes the resilience of their bond in the face of adversity, celebrating the profound connection forged amidst the wreckage of their pasts. "All Of The Girls You Loved Before" emerges as a poignant testament to the redemptive power of love and the indomitable spirit that perseveres through life's tumultuous journey.
